Transaction 39d2f82959421512294a0e1603f25cf9f802ab4f7cb07a64a4dd0b37b4acb77f

1 Input
2 Outputs
  • 39d2f82959421512294a0e1603f25cf9f802ab4f7cb07a64a4dd0b37b4acb77f:0
  • value  4328521
    address  3DFQM7eFmmv2mNGTWUT8MMZf2b6Bz6Gdod
  • 39d2f82959421512294a0e1603f25cf9f802ab4f7cb07a64a4dd0b37b4acb77f:1
  • value  19076018
    address  17MGbbjxZGPFzDvxrDMsdm4gr8yV1CqCS7